Faucon is a commune in the Vaucluse department of France, situated within the arrondissement of Carpentras. It lies in the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ur region and has an area of 8.65 square kilometers. The municipality borders Mérindol-les-Oliviers, Mollans-sur-Ouvèze, Entrechaux, and Puyméras. Its postal code is 84110, and it is located at an elevation of 459 meters above sea level.
The population of Faucon is recorded as 454, comprising 211 males and 222 females. Another source lists the population as 407. The commune is part of the canton of Vaison-la-Romaine. Its official website is mairiedefaucon.fr.
